#3a344f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a344f is composed of 22.7% red, 20.4%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.6%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 253.3 degrees, a saturation of 20.6% and a lightness of 25.7%. #3a344f color hex could be obtained by blending #74689e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3a344f color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#3a344f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a344f has RGB values of R:58, G:52,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 3814479.
